Comment (by mdickens at nd.edu):
I've just attached a new tarball, which contains the changes needed to get
the PYTHONPATH correct for the Framework install ; to include both
{{{${Framework}/.../lib/python2.5/}}} and {{{${prefix}/lib/python2.5/site-
packages/}}} . Checking the {{{sys.path}}}, these mods work as desired (I
borrowed them from the python24 port, so this is no surprise).
py25-hashlib and related ports should install and execute without needing
the augment the PYTHONPATH in the Port environment (as was the case in
python24).
